In 2013, Blue Man Group in Chicago sponsored a one-of-a-kind art competition, and Kathy Duffin Czopek ’91 was one of six winners. Czopek, from St. Louis, painted “Blue Frenzy” which was inspired by the energy, colors, rhythm and chaos of the live Blue Man Group experience.
